Ethereum ETF Exceeds Expectations in First Week, Institutional Inflow Accelerates

With the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) officially approving the listing of spot Ethereum exchange-traded funds (ETFs), the cryptocurrency market has seen a new wave of capital inflows. According to multiple market data providers, Ethereum ETFs recorded significant net inflows in their first week, far exceeding prior industry expectations, signaling that institutional investors' demand for mainstream digital assets is extending from Bitcoin to Ethereum.

Impressive First-Week Inflow Data

According to publicly available fund flow data, Ethereum ETFs attracted net inflows totaling several hundred million dollars in their first week. Among them, products from leading asset managers such as BlackRock and Fidelity performed particularly well, with first-day trading volumes breaking historical records. In comparison, when Bitcoin ETFs launched in early 2024, their first-week net inflows were several times larger than current Ethereum ETF figures. However, considering that Ethereum's market cap is roughly one-third of Bitcoin's, the relative proportion of these inflows is quite substantial.

Analysts point out that the rapid capital attraction of Ethereum ETFs is mainly due to two factors: first, Ethereum's core position as a smart contract platform, with its ecosystem including DeFi and NFT applications continuously attracting developers and users; second, institutional investors, after reaching saturation in Bitcoin ETF allocations, are seeking diversified digital asset exposure.

Market Reaction and Price Impact

Following the listing of Ethereum ETFs, the price of ETH experienced notable short-term volatility. According to CoinGecko data, ETH rose approximately 10% in the first week before pulling back slightly due to profit-taking. Overall, market sentiment leans bullish, with futures funding rates remaining in positive territory, indicating that long positions dominate. Similar to the launch of Bitcoin ETFs, the introduction of Ethereum ETFs is seen as another milestone in the convergence of traditional finance and the crypto world.

However, some traders caution that ETF-driven capital inflows are not linear. Bitcoin ETFs also experienced significant volatility in their early days, followed by a months-long consolidation period. Whether Ethereum ETFs can replicate Bitcoin's long-term upward trajectory depends on the macroeconomic environment, regulatory policies, and progress on Ethereum's own technological upgrades, such as the upcoming Pectra upgrade.

Comparison with Bitcoin ETF Historical Performance

Looking back at the historical performance of Bitcoin ETFs after their launch, first-week inflows were about 3-4 times larger than current Ethereum ETF figures. However, the inflow speed and market attention for Ethereum ETFs have exceeded most analysts' expectations. After Bitcoin ETFs launched in January 2024, they propelled Bitcoin's price from around $40,000 to over $70,000 within three months, eventually breaking the $100,000 mark by year-end. If Ethereum ETFs follow a similar trajectory, ETH prices could challenge historical highs in the medium term.

Yet, there are key differences: Bitcoin ETFs launched amid rising expectations of Fed rate cuts, with global liquidity easing supporting risk assets. In contrast, the current market faces challenges such as persistent inflation and geopolitical uncertainties. Additionally, Ethereum's supply mechanism (partial burning) differs from Bitcoin's fixed supply, potentially affecting its price elasticity.

Institutional Inflow Accelerates, Ecosystem Impact Far-Reaching

The listing of Ethereum ETFs not only brings direct capital inflows but also marks a new phase in institutional investors' acceptance of crypto assets. According to industry reports, several pension funds, endowments, and family offices have begun evaluating the allocation value of Ethereum ETFs. Some institutions indicate that Ethereum's staking yield mechanism could become an additional highlight for future ETF products, although current approved ETFs do not include staking features.

From a broader perspective, the launch of Ethereum ETFs is expected to accelerate the compliance process of the Ethereum ecosystem. As traditional financial institutions indirectly hold ETH through ETFs, Ethereum's network security, governance transparency, and developer support may receive more resources. In the long run, this could drive Ethereum's transformation from a "digital asset" to a "digital infrastructure."

Future Outlook and Risk Warnings

Looking ahead, the sustainability of Ethereum ETF inflows depends on several variables: first, the direction of Fed monetary policy—if rate cut expectations rise again, it could stimulate capital inflows into risk assets; second, technological progress on the Ethereum network, especially the implementation of Layer2 scaling solutions; and finally, regulatory developments, including the SEC's stance on approving other crypto asset ETFs.

Despite short-term volatility risks, the better-than-expected first-week performance of Ethereum ETFs has injected confidence into the crypto market. Just as Bitcoin ETFs pioneered institutional allocation to digital assets, Ethereum ETFs may become the next major milestone, further integrating the industry into mainstream finance.
